Zinc powder is then added to solidify the dissolved gold. To smelt into bars a chemical cocktail is prepared – manganese dioxide, fluoride, silica flour, borax and sodium nitrate. This mix – called flux – separates the gold from the impurities. Smelting occurs at 1600 degrees centigrade. The smelter is rotated so that the contents heat evenly.

Metal Casting. In relation to metalworking, casting is the process in which metal is liquefied and poured into a mold which is then cooled and solidified into the shape of the mold''s cavity. The solidified piece of metal also referred to as the casting or ingot is then released from the mold to complete the process.

Most karat gold casting alloys contain gold, silver and copper along with a small percentage of zinc. White golds have nickel instead of silver, but still contain zinc. One of the more popular casting process in use is called lost wax casting or investment casting. In lost wax casting a model is created from wax and affixed to the base to hold it in place. The model is placed in a flask and covered in a type of plaster, after which the flask is put into a vacuum chamber to remove air, reports The Rams Horn studio.

Gold Star Omega is our premium quality investment powder with the highest percentage of cristobalite, a key ingredient for higher melting temperature gold alloys including Palladium White Gold. The thermal expansion, particle size distribution and greater permeability work to produce the optimum quality of casting.

Investment casting is generally used for making complexshaped components that require tighter tolerances, thinner walls and better surface finish than can be obtained with sand casting.
